During the early hours of the morning a vehicle laden with flammable gas canisters was driven - apparently deliberately - into the front of the offices of the council buildings housing both South Oxfordshire and the Vale of White Horse District Councils. The resulting fire has all but destroyed the building. While 13 fire crews were on site, two more fires were raging one nearby and one in the village of Rokemarsh just three miles north, started deliberately and again involving highly explosive gas cylinders.
